Official synopsis Publisher

The story “Cercano Fredericksburg,” is set near the small Texas town of Fredericksburg which was settled in 1854. “Cercano” in Spanish simply means, “near.” The story deals with the North from Mexico theme so familiar to the peoples of the states bordering Mexico. It is the author’s hope that the reader will see Uncle Kunkle and Tante Anna as “every man and “every woman.” When Uncle Kunkle and Tante Anna learn to smile, they have realized that Love is the answer. When they begin to share the benefits of the land on which they live, they see how much they have to share. In their sharing, they fill their lives with joy. The Socorro family is the symbol for the hopes and dreams of humankind. The book is simply a story or it can become an entire study of the way in which our country was built.
